Signs Your Sedalia Heating System Needs a Tune-Up

When your heating system isn't performing as it should, your home quickly becomes uncomfortable. Recognizing the early warning signs can save you from a complete breakdown and costly repairs. Here are the key indicators that your Sedalia heating system is due for professional attention.

Inconsistent Heating or Cold Spots

You walk into a room and it feels noticeably colder than the rest of the house, even when the thermostat is set to a comfortable temperature. In Sedalia, these cold spots can be particularly frustrating with our rapid day-to-night temperature swings, making certain areas feel perpetually chilly. This often indicates uneven heat distribution, restricted airflow, or a system struggling to generate enough warmth, possibly due to a clogged filter, a malfunctioning blower, or issues with your ductwork. Beyond discomfort, inconsistent heating means your system is working harder, consuming more energy without achieving desired results, and if ignored, it can lead to premature wear on components and escalate into a complete heating failure during Sedalia's frigid winters.

Unusually High Energy Bills

Your monthly utility statements are significantly higher than previous years, or even higher than your neighbors', without a corresponding increase in usage. This is especially concerning for Sedalia residents with older, less efficient systems working overtime to combat the cold. This typically means your heating system is losing efficiency, consuming more fuel or electricity to produce the same amount of heat, often due to dirty components, a failing thermostat, or a system that's simply not calibrated correctly. Wasted energy means wasted money, and continuously operating an inefficient system puts undue strain on its components, accelerating wear and tear and increasing the likelihood of costly repairs or an early system replacement.

Excessive Dust or Poor Indoor Air Quality

Despite regular cleaning, dust seems to accumulate quickly on surfaces. You might also experience more dry skin, static electricity, or even aggravated allergy symptoms, which is a common complaint in Sedalia's dry, dusty environment. This usually means your heating system's air filter might be clogged, or the ductwork could be dirty or leaky. When the system can't filter air effectively or is pulling in unfiltered air from unconditioned spaces, it recirculates dust and allergens throughout your home. Poor indoor air quality can impact your family's health and comfort, and a clogged filter further restricts airflow, forcing your system to work harder, which reduces efficiency and can lead to overheating and damage to the blower motor.

Strange Noises or Odors from Your System

You hear grinding, squealing, rattling, or banging sounds coming from your furnace, or detect unusual smells like burning dust, mustiness, or even a metallic odor when your heat kicks on. Noises often indicate mechanical issues like a failing motor bearing, a loose component, or a dirty blower fan. Burning smells are typically dust on heating elements, but metallic or electrical smells can signal more serious problems. These sounds and smells are warnings you shouldn't ignore, as they can lead to component failure, potential safety hazards, or a complete system breakdown, requiring emergency Heating Repair & Service instead of preventative maintenance.

Frequent Cycling or Constant Running

Your furnace turns on and off frequently (short cycling) or runs almost continuously without reaching the set temperature, particularly noticeable during Sedalia's coldest nights. Short cycling can be caused by an oversized system, a dirty flame sensor, or a malfunctioning thermostat. Constant running usually points to an undersized system, a clogged filter, or a thermostat issue preventing it from reaching temperature. Both scenarios indicate inefficiency and stress on your system; short cycling leads to premature wear, while constant running wastes energy, and both significantly shorten the lifespan of your heating unit and increase the risk of unexpected breakdowns.

What's Really Going On: Common Heating System Issues in Sedalia

Understanding the common culprits behind your heating system's struggles can help you appreciate the value of professional maintenance. Many issues stem from simple neglect or the demanding conditions of our local climate.

Neglected Air Filter

Over time, the air filter in your furnace collects dust, pet dander, and other airborne particles. A clogged filter restricts airflow, making your system work harder to pull air through, leading to reduced efficiency and potential overheating. Sedalia's dry, often windy conditions and rural environment mean there's a higher concentration of airborne dust, pollen, and even agricultural particulate matter, causing filters to clog much faster than in more urban or humid environments, making regular checks crucial. Replacing or cleaning the air filter regularly, typically every 1-3 months depending on usage and home conditions, is a simple yet critical maintenance step, and our tune-ups always include filter inspection and replacement recommendations.

Lack of Annual Professional Maintenance

Without regular professional tune-ups, heating systems accumulate dirt, components wear down, and minor issues go unnoticed. This directly leads to decreased efficiency, higher energy consumption, and a greater risk of unexpected breakdowns. With Sedalia's demanding winters, heating systems are put through their paces for extended periods, and skipping annual maintenance means these systems are more likely to fail under the heavy load, especially older units in less insulated homes trying to combat the extreme cold. A comprehensive heating maintenance and tune-up by a certified technician involves cleaning, inspecting, lubricating, and testing all vital components to ensure optimal performance and identify potential problems before they escalate.

Dirty or Uncalibrated Components

Over time, dirt and grime can build up on critical components like the blower motor, heat exchanger, and burners. Thermostats can also become uncalibrated, leading to inaccurate temperature readings and inefficient operation. The high levels of dust and fine particulate matter in Sedalia's environment mean that internal components can become significantly dirtier, faster, and this accumulation acts as an insulator, reducing heat transfer and forcing the system to work harder. Our technicians thoroughly clean all internal components, ensuring they operate without obstruction, and we also inspect and calibrate thermostats to guarantee accurate temperature control and system cycling.

Wear and Tear from Heavy Usage

Every time your heating system cycles on and off, its mechanical and electrical components experience stress. Over years of operation, particularly during long, cold winters, parts like bearings, belts, and electrical contacts can degrade or fail. Sedalia's extended and often intensely cold winters mean heating systems run for more hours and under more strenuous conditions than in milder climates, and this accelerated usage naturally leads to faster wear and tear on vital parts. During a tune-up, our experts meticulously inspect all moving parts, electrical connections, and safety controls, lubricating components, tightening connections, and advising on timely replacement of worn parts to prevent more significant failures.

What to Expect During Your Heating Maintenance & Tune-Up Visit

When you schedule a heating maintenance and tune-up with Colorado Bear Heating & Air for your Sedalia home, you can expect a transparent, thorough, and professional service experience. Our licensed and insured technicians, backed by over 20 years of industry experience, will arrive promptly, ready to ensure your system is in peak condition. We understand the specific demands placed on heating systems in the Sedalia area, and our process is designed to address them.

Here's a general overview of what our expert service involves:

  • Comprehensive System Inspection: We'll start with a detailed visual inspection of your entire heating system, including the furnace, thermostat, and ductwork, looking for any obvious signs of wear, damage, or potential issues.
  • Thorough Cleaning: Our technicians will clean critical components such as the burners, heat exchanger, blower motor, and flame sensor. This removes accumulated dust and debris common in Sedalia's environment, which can hinder efficiency and airflow.
  • Air Filter Check & Replacement: We'll inspect your air filter and, if necessary, replace it with a new one (customer-provided or purchased from us). This is crucial for maintaining good indoor air quality and system efficiency.
  • Lubrication of Moving Parts: All moving parts, such as the blower motor bearings, will be lubricated to reduce friction, prevent premature wear, and ensure quiet operation.
  • Electrical Connection Check: We'll inspect and tighten all electrical connections to ensure safe operation and prevent potential shorts or failures.
  • Thermostat Calibration & Testing: Your thermostat will be checked for accuracy and proper functionality, ensuring it’s communicating correctly with your heating system and maintaining consistent temperatures.
  • Safety Control Assessment: Crucial safety features like the high-limit switch and rollout switch will be tested to ensure they are functioning correctly, providing peace of mind for your family.
  • Operational Testing & Performance Check: Finally, we'll run your heating system through a full cycle, measuring airflow, temperature rise, and overall performance to confirm it's operating efficiently and effectively for your Sedalia home. We'll provide a detailed report of our findings and any recommendations.

Why Heating Maintenance Matters: The True Cost of Waiting

Delaying or skipping your annual heating maintenance isn't just about minor inconveniences; it carries significant risks and costs that can impact your comfort, safety, and finances. A neglected heating system can develop serious issues, including carbon monoxide leaks from a cracked heat exchanger, electrical fires, or gas leaks. Regular tune-ups detect these hazards early, protecting your family and your Sedalia property.

Minor issues, if left unaddressed, almost always transform into major, expensive repairs. A worn belt might only cost a small amount to replace during maintenance, but if it snaps, it could damage other components, leading to a much larger Heating Repair & Service bill. Furthermore, an inefficient heating system works harder and consumes more fuel to achieve the same level of comfort, which translates directly to inflated utility bills throughout Sedalia's long, cold winters, costing you hundreds of dollars annually in wasted energy. Just like a car, a heating system that isn't regularly maintained will wear out faster; neglect accelerates the degradation of components, leading to premature system failure and the need for a costly full replacement much sooner than anticipated. Without proper maintenance, your heating system is more prone to unexpected breakdowns, often occurring during the coldest days when you need it most, leaving you scrambling for emergency repairs and facing uncomfortable cold spells.
